"Dinosaurs exist and the Nazis have them!" is the tag line for Dino D-Day, a multiplayer shooter set in World War 2 that lets you play as a T-Rex with shoulder-mounted machine guns, or a Velociraptor, or a squidgy human with a gun, among other things. We're teaming up with Bundle Stars to give away a million Steam keys for free, because everyone deserves to become a T-Rex and enjoy a rampage every once in a while. Read on to redeem your key and start playing.

Welcome to week two of our absurdly large five-week giveaway, in which we give away up to a million Steam keys each week. The keys are supplied by Bundle Stars, known for grouping top games into money-saving bundles. They also sell games individually at up-to 95% off.

Dino D-Day was released in 2011, but is due a major update soon, overhauling the graphics and moving the game to a sharper version of the Source engine. It's set in an alterna-history scenario in which Hitler creates an army of lizards and rampages across Europe. It's a good enough excuse to jump into the body of a Triceratops and headbutt the marauding menace to death. There are seven playable dinosaur classes, and nine human classes, and dozens of guns.
